Where does “умный” come from?
умный (Russian) comes from Russian у́м, from Old East Slavic умъ, from Proto-Slavic umъ, from Proto-Indo-European h₂ew-m-, from Proto-Indo-European h₂ew- — to enjoy; to consume; to perceive, see, to be...
Ancestry of “умный”, step by step
| Step | Language | Word | Meaning |
|---|
| 1 | Russian | у́м | — |
| 2 | Old East Slavic | умъ | mind, intellect |
| 3 | Proto-Slavic | umъ | mind |
| 4 | Proto-Indo-European | h₂ew-m- | — |
| 5 | Proto-Indo-European | h₂ew- | to enjoy; to consume; to perceive, see, to be... |
